Advertising seems to be the backbone of Internet and many companies have made big business with it. New ideas are emerging, with companies trying to get the Internet back, own it, or get a share of it! It is a bit too early to tell how the new Agloco is doing, as they are still in Beta form and have not even distributed their Viewbar, which will monitor the time people spend surfing on the Internet. Take the Internet back only started a few weeks ago too and people are only now starting to get the ad emails which will bring the money. Paid to click ads have been around for a while though and there are more sites being created all the time. Their names are tricky too, as they always include magic words like gains, wealth, dollar, pay, money, lightening, fast and free. The truth is that there is little money, gain or wealth and things are not free or fast either. On the contrary! Once you join they immediately flood you with emails. One is supposed to click and then view the ad for a minimum of 10, 15, 20 or even 40 seconds. But it is not really 10 seconds that it takes, as one first has to wait for the document to open. Then they are scared of people cheating so they have about 5 numbers and one has to click on the right one, to proof one is human and not a machine! Those numbers are sometimes hard to read, so often there is a bit of guesswork involved, as one must click on something just because two digits were the same! All this guesswork, of course, takes a bit of time. Once the ad comes up one sees how much it pays. The fees vary and they can be as low as 0.25, (not 0.25 dollars, but 0.25 cents, which means a quarter of a cent)! That means one has to click on four such ads to collect just 1 cent! The most generous sites pay .023 or .028, which might sound like a lot, but that is just over two cents, but not quite three! In that case you would reach 10 cents after viewing 4 or 5 such ads!” Once the stipulated time has gone by, one clicks and the amount is credited to your account. Having a look at your account brings surprises, as numbers that you imagined golden before suddenly turn into peanuts! Your eyes play funny tricks on you too, as they can wander far in just those 10 or 15 seconds. They suddenly see things and automatically respond by clicking your mouse and the whole process is prolonged, so what was supposed to last just 10 seconds is no more! Games and competitions also offer distractions and fingers just can’t resist clicking on those either! All this of course is without mentioning that many times your country was not included, so all your seconds are lost! After a few days of doing this you realise that you must look for something else, as pay to click ads is not an el Dorado!
